Minor spoilers for Spider-Man: No Way Home follow - you've been warned!

If you've watched the (first) post-credits scene for Spider-Man: No Way Home, then you'll have some idea of what we can expect from Tom Holland's next outing as the wallcrawler: Symbiote-based action.

2021's massive multiverse adventure ends with Tom Hardy's Venom, having only just arrived in the MCU as part of Doctor Strange's botched spell, being pulled back into his own universe before he can meet Spider-Man.

Disappointing for fans, no doubt. But Venom leaves behind a little present: a tiny dollop of the symbiote now exists in the MCU, and is all but guaranteed to cross paths with Spider-Man in a future movie.

Take a look at our Spider-Man: No Way Home with Tom Holland below!

It seems pretty clear from this post-credits scene that Tom Holland's Spidey will finally have his very own symbiote storyline. Whether or not Tom Hardy returns as Venom for this remains to be seen, but I'm willing to bet my comic book collection that we'll see Spidey in the iconic black suit sooner rather than later.

While this has yet to be confirmed, concept artist Thomas du Crest has shared their take on what Holland's Spider-Man could look like after bonding with the Venom symbiote in a potential Spider-Man 4.

du Crest has worked a ton of Marvel movies, including Avengers Endgame and No Way Home, although they stress the images they've shared are simply their take on what might come next, and should by no means be taken as an official tease.

Personally, I'd be very happy if du Crest's take on the black suit was anything like what we end up getting, because it's gorgeous. Take a look for yourself below.

I love it. After Spider-Man 3 delivered a version of the black suit that was literally just the original Raimi suit spray painted black and grey, I'm ready for a more comic-accurate version of one of the sleekest Spider-Man costumes around. Here's hoping Tom Holland's next movie delivers the goods.
